Grandview Students recently wrote "My Holiday Wish" letters to support the Make a Wish Foundation. A.J. Silvestri, a 15 year old Old Bridge, NJ resident and Make a Wish recipient, charged New Jersey residents to write 250,000 letters about their holiday wishes-in return, Macy's would donate $1 per letter to the Make a Wish Foundation. We are so proud of our Grandview Students who contributed 305 letters toward A.J.'s campaign.

Mrs. Schechter and
Mrs. Shay's third grade class worked with Mrs. Toth and Mrs. Tarantino's kindergarten class on The Marshmallow Challenge, a STEM project. Each kindergartner was partnered with a third grader. The partnerships had 20 minutes to build a tower out of only spaghetti and tape that would hold a marshmallow at the very top. The tallest tower wins. Sister and brother team, Ava and Nicholas Poveromo, won the challenge with their tower topping 11 inches. The two classes enjoyed problem solving together. Great work!
